http://www.neargov.org/en/page.jsp?mnu_uid=3790& WebbOrkhon valley in 1891, Radloff began to dedicate himself ardently to the problem of the runiform script, competing with Vilhelm Thomsen in deciphering it. When Thomsen won the contest, Radloff took this victory as a personal defeat, and a bitter feud began between the two scholars. The foremost scholar among those who now began to develop a

WebbThe Orkhon Valley is an extensive area of pasture land which stretches c. 80km in length and 15km in width between the banks of the Orkhon river.
